Printed aerial photography
Purchase printed maps of aerial photography with a selection of additional layers designed specifically to complement the photo base. The most current imagery available was flown in June 2022. Imagery dating back to 1993 is available at various resolutions. Maps can be scaled to fit your area of interest and have a 34" x 34" image area on a 36" x 44" page.

Digital aerial imagery
Digital imagery files are available to work with your Geographic Information System and raster image software. The most recent aerial photos, from June 2021, are available by the section (one square mile) and available in 6" resolution. Imagery from previous years are available on request, and resolution varies by year. 2014 imagery is available at 3" resolution and is available by the quarter section (1/4 square mile).
- natural color, ortho-rectified digital imagery
- TIFF image format
- 6-inch pixel, high resolution imagery covering both urban and rural areas of greater Portland
- imagery divided into 602 PLSS sections
- imagery from past years available at limited resolutions and various file types.
